Recession pressures ‘will increase mental health demand’

Debt, homelessness and unemployment will increase demand for mental health services, according to Liberal Democrat health spokesman Norman Lamb. Lamb was commenting on a bulletin from the NHS Information Centre which showed increasing numbers of people seeking help from mental health services in 2006-07. “Ministers must end the neglect of mental health services,” Mr Lamb… Read more »

Prisoners better protected than mentally ill

Patients in psychiatric hospitals need to be given the same ‘right to life’ as prisoners, civil liberties group Liberty said today. Liberty have intervened in a Law Lords appeal and called for patients to receive better protection after paranoid schizophrenia sufferer Carol Savage committed suicide after escaping from hospital.
